Ladies Reserves Game Postponed Again

Last updated : 21 April 2005 By Covsupport
Coventry City Ladies Reserves final game of the season on Sunday has again been postponed. Despite having been ordered by the FA to play the game, Middlesbrough Ladies Reserves have again refused due to events on December 19th which saw the game between the two sides at Middlesbrough abandoned after 55 minutes.

CCLFC Reserve Team Secretary Tim Kalns said: "Middlesbrough have this assurance from all at CCLFC. Your girls, their parents and Middlesbrough Ladies FC have absolutely nothing to fear by playing the oustanding fixture in Coventry this weekend. We will do our utmost to make you all feel very welcome."

The matter has been again referred to the FA Women's Premier League.
